Statement From Leader Of Opposition 28 January

Liberal Party Victoria
Today, the Victorian Liberal Party Room elected David Southwick as Deputy Leader of the Liberal Party.

I again take this opportunity to thank Sam Groth for his service to the Liberal Party and Nepean community over the past three years and look forward to continuing to work together in the months ahead.

David brings significant experience, enthusiasm and energy to this important role and shares our team's complete commitment to delivering a credible alternative government that Victorians want to elect.

Member for South-West Coast, Roma Britnell, will assume the role of Shadow Cabinet Secretary following Joe McCracken's announcement that he will not contest the upcoming election.

For the past year, Joe has served in this important role with distinction, and I am confident Roma will continue this outstanding work in the lead up to the November election.
